#BA436E Hex Color Code

#BA436E

The Hexadecimal Color #BA436E is a contrast shade of Indian Red. #BA436E RGB value is rgb(186, 67, 110). RGB Color Model of #BA436E consists of 72% red, 26% green and 43% blue. HSL color Mode of #BA436E has 338°(degrees) Hue, 47% Saturation and 50% Lightness. #BA436E color has an wavelength of 407.18519n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#BA436E is #CC6699.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#BA436E is #B46. The Closest Color to #BA436E is #CD5C5C. Official Name of #BA436E Hex Code is Blush.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#BA436E is 0 Cyan 64 Magenta 41 Yellow 27 Black and #BA436E CMY is 0, 64, 41.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#BA436E is hsl(338,47,50,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(338, 64, 73).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#BA436E is 25.07, 15.58, 16.44.
Hex8 Value of #BA436E is #BA436EFF. Decimal Value of #BA436E is 12206958 and Octal Value of #BA436E is 56441556. Binary Value of #BA436E is 10111010, 1000011, 1101110 and Android of #BA436E is 4290397038 / 0xffba436e.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#BA436E is 0.439, 0.273, 0.273 and YIQ Color Space of #BA436E is 107.483, 57.0962, 38.5501.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#BA436E is 22.39, 8.91, 16.45.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#BA436E is 46.42, 51.61, 1.12.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#BA436E is 46.42, 77.03, -7.98.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#BA436E is 46.42, 51.62, 1.24. Hunter Lab variable of #BA436E is 39.47, 44.3, 2.94.

Various Color Shades of #BA436E

To get 25% Saturated #BA436E Color, you need to convert the hex color #BA436E to the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, increase the saturation value by 25%, and then convert it back to the hex color. To desaturate a color by 25%, we need to reduce its saturation level while keeping the same hue and lightness. Saturation represents the intensity or vividness of a color. A 100% saturation means the color is fully vivid, while a 0% saturation results in a shade of gray. To make a color 25% darker or 25% lighter, you need to reduce the intensity of each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components by 25% or increase it to 25%. Inverting a #BA436E hex color involves converting each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components to their complementary values. The complementary color is found by subtracting each component's value from the maximum value of 255.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#BA436E

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
